I was really excited about the automask shortcut, but "ctrl" doesn't seem to work for me. I'm trying it right now. After a search I found the "A" key does it for me. A on A off. Am I doing something wrong or has hit changed since August of last year?
@MattKloskowski5 жыл бұрын
Hi. A is the key for officially turning it on and off. Ctrl (cmd on Mac) is the key for temporarily turning it on while you're painting but as soon as you let it go, it goes back to normal. I'm not sure why it wouldn't work though.
